Calla lily bouquets: a flower that reads as a line

Hand-tied calla lilies with all stems curving the same way

Most bouquets are read as a mass of colour. A calla is read as a drawing: one curved stem, one funnel at the top, and a good deal of empty space around both.

That difference decides who they suit. The flower has no ruffles, almost no scent and no visible complexity, so it says something restrained rather than warm. It works for a formal handover, an opening, an apology to someone who would find a large red armful embarrassing, and for weddings, where the calla has been standard for a century. What it does badly is exuberance.

Nobody has ever called a calla bouquet cheerful.

The gesture

White callas carry a double reading that is worth knowing before you send them. Across much of Europe they are a wedding flower and a funeral one at the same time, and the same stem appears at both. Context does most of the work in practice, and nobody handed a tied bouquet on a Tuesday afternoon reads it as sympathy. Still, the association is real, and it is why some florists steer away from a plain white calla sheaf for a birthday. A coloured cultivar in burgundy, apricot or yellow removes the question completely.

The other thing to know is that this bouquet makes a claim about the recipient's taste. Sending one says you assumed they prefer restraint, which flatters when it is true and chills when it is not.

In a room

Calla lily bouquets want a tall narrow vase and nothing else. The stems are heavy low down and the funnels sit high, so a wide bowl lets them splay and the drawing collapses into a tangle. Three to five stems in a straight glass cylinder is the entire arrangement.

They also need a plain background. The silhouette is the whole point, and against a patterned wall or a crowded shelf it disappears, while the same stems in front of a blank wall carry across a room. This is the rare bouquet that improves as the space around it empties out. Clinics and quiet offices use them for exactly that reason.

Give the vase a spot where nobody has to squeeze past it.

Handling

Single calla stem in a narrow vase against a plain wall

The fragile part is the stem, not the flower. It is fleshy and hollow with no woody core, so it bends smoothly along a curve and snaps at once if it is folded at a single point. A kink cannot be undone: the vessels are crushed, water stops travelling past that point, and the head above it droops within a day. That is why callas are never tied tightly across the middle or pushed into a narrow sleeve, and why a courier carries them upright and apart from other orders. The same care applies at home whenever the vase gets moved.

Water goes in shallow. The cut end turns soft and slimy if half the stem is submerged, so two fingers of clean water, changed often, plus a fresh trim every few days, keeps the stem firm.

Cold damage shows on the edge of the spathe as a brown rim. It does not spread and it does not fade, which makes it permanent and obvious on a white cultivar. On a dark burgundy one the same damage is nearly invisible, worth remembering when you choose a colour.

They last well for a flower this soft. A calla does not shatter or drop petals, it loses tension slowly over a week or more until the funnel slackens.
